SPEEA, Spirit continue contract debate

Published 12:38 pm Thursday, August 13, 2009

Boeing supplier Spirit AeroSystems went back to the negotiating table today with engineering union SPEEA.

Last month, SPEEA members at the Wichita, Kansas site voted down Spirit’s contract by a large margin – 91 percent of the members who voted rejected the offer. SPEEA represents 774 engineers at the Spirit location.

The two sides reconvened today, but SPEEA leaders say they’re displeased with Spirit’s offer.

“Four years ago our engineers helped start Spirit and make it successful after its divestiture from The Boeing Company,” said Ray Goforth, SPEEA executive director, in a press release. “Executives pocketed millions and now want to pick the pockets of workers.”

Spirit and SPEEA are trying to negotiate a 3 ½ year contract.

Boeing and SPEEA signed a new 4 year contract for engineers and technical workers in the Puget Sound region late last year.
